Existing tea tree mushroom strains suffer from problems such as poor genetic stability, low extracellular enzyme activity, long production cycle, weak substrate degradation ability, and poor commercial traits during the breeding process, making it difficult to meet industry demands.
Using the protoplast mononuclear hybridization method, the disease-resistant 'Zhongjun Baicha No. 1' and the 'Tongmao Gu' which has a strong ability to degrade cellulose and lignin in the matrix were used as parents. Through protoplast mononuclear hybridization, a new variety of tea tree mushroom, 'Fucha No. 1' (WCS1-9), was obtained, and its genetic characteristics were marked by InDel markers.
The newly obtained variety 'Fucha No. 1' is characterized by high yield, high quality, strong disease resistance, good production stability, excellent commercial traits, shortened production cycle, and increased yield by 8.48%. Its overall commercial traits are superior to the control variety.

[0002] Tea tree mushroom ( Agrocybe aegerita (V.Brig.)Singer) is a fungus used for both food and medicine. It contains a variety of amino acids needed by the human body and has special effects such as anti-aging, cholesterol reduction, cancer prevention and anti-cancer.
[0003] Currently, the only commonly used methods for breeding *Agrocybe aegerita* strains are wild domestication and hybridization breeding. The improvement of edible fungi strains in my country, especially hybridization breeding, started late and is at a low level. Existing cultivated varieties cannot meet the needs of rapidly developing production. Therefore, developing new varieties is fundamental to the vigorous development of the edible fungi cultivation industry. In the process of edible fungi breeding, protoplast monokaryotic hybridization is a common method. By hybridizing two monokaryotic strains, the genetic material of the hybrid strains will recombine or exchange. Compared with other breeding methods, this method retains the superior traits of other strains and is not limited by seasonal conditions.
[0004] The nutrients required for the growth and development of edible fungi are mainly provided by the cultivation substrate. The mycelium in the substrate produces extracellular enzymes that break down large-molecule nutrients, ultimately utilizing smaller-molecule nutrients for absorption, transformation, and utilization. Artificially cultivated *Agrocybe aegerita* (tea tree mushroom) often uses cottonseed hulls as the cultivation substrate, which is rich in natural polymers such as cellulose, hemicellulose, lignin, and starch. This substrate can induce the mycelium to produce various extracellular degrading enzymes, including carboxymethyl cellulase, amylase, and laccase. Under the action of these extracellular enzymes, exogenous nutrients are degraded, yielding abundant carbon and nitrogen sources. Extracellular degrading enzymes play a crucial role in the growth and development of *Agrocybe aegerita*. The activity level of these enzymes is critical to the efficiency of nutrient utilization in the cultivation substrate, thus affecting the characteristics and quality of the fruiting bodies.
[0005] Therefore, guided by industry needs, the selection and breeding of *Agrocybe aegerita* strains with genetic stability, high extracellular enzyme activity, short production cycle, strong substrate degradation ability, and excellent commercial characteristics has become the focus and challenge of new strain research. [0015] Tested strains ‘Zhongjunbaicha No. 1’ (BC1): The strain was provided by Kunming Mushroom Research Institute of China National General Supply and Marketing Cooperative, and the cap of the strain is white tea tree mushroom, and the fruiting body is relatively neat.
[0016] ‘Tongmaoshu’ (CS3): The strain was provided by Jiannian Mushroom Research Institute of Gutian County, and the cap of the strain is gray tea tree mushroom, which is the main variety at present.
[0017] Example 1: Breeding of ‘Fucha No. 1’ WCS1-9 strain The breeding of the new variety ‘Fucha No. 1’ (WCS1-9) specifically includes the following steps: 1.1 Preparation of single nucleus strain Five tea tree mushroom blocks (10 mm in diameter) were inoculated into liquid PDA rich medium, and cultured at 25℃ in the dark for 8 days. The mycelium was collected by four layers of non-woven fabric, washed twice with 0.6 mol / L mannitol solution, and the excess water was absorbed with absorbent paper. 500 mg of mycelium was weighed and placed in a 10 mL centrifuge tube. A 0.22 µm bacterial filter was used to add 5 mL of 1.5% lywallzyme solution (purchased from Beijing Solabio Technology Co., Ltd.) to the centrifuge tube containing the mycelium, shaken, mixed, and enzymolyzed at 30℃ for 2.5 h. The protoplast enzymolysis was observed under a microscope every 30 min. After the enzymolysis was completed, the enzymolysis liquid was filtered into a 10 mL centrifuge tube with four layers of non-woven fabric, and was balanced with 0.6 mol / L mannitol solution. The supernatant was discarded after centrifugation at 4℃ and 876g for 20 min. The precipitate was resuspended in 200 μL of 0.6 mol / L mannitol solution to prepare a protoplast suspension. 10 μL was taken and spread on the regeneration medium, and cultured at 25℃ in the dark for 9 days. On the 9th day, smaller star-shaped colonies were picked and transferred to PDA rich medium, and cultured at 25℃.
[0018] The preparation of the regeneration medium is as follows: 200 g of potato, 20 g of anhydrous glucose, 205.38 g of sucrose, 1 g of maltose, 20 g of agar, and distilled water to 1000 ml, pH natural, sterilized at 115°C for 30 min.
[0019] 1.2 Obtaining mycelium 1.2.1 Monokaryon strain: After the mycelium of the single colony to be picked grows, it is observed under an optical microscope to determine whether it is a monokaryon strain. If there is lock-like combination, it is not a monokaryon strain; otherwise, it is a monokaryon strain. Four generations of culture are used to observe whether lock-like combination occurs to determine the stability of the monokaryon strain.
[0020] The single colonies picked are observed under a microscope. 12 monokaryon strains are obtained from BC1, and 1 monokaryon strain is obtained from CS3. Compared with the preparation of monokaryon strains from protoplasts of BC1, the preparation of monokaryon strains from CS3 is more difficult.
[0021] 1.2.2 Diakaryon hybrid strain: Single-single hybridization is used to hybridize two parent monokaryon strains, which are cultured in a 25°C constant temperature incubator. The area covered by the mycelium of both parent monokaryon strains is transferred to a new culture medium for 3 days of culture. The culture is observed under an optical microscope. If there is lock-like combination, it is a hybrid strain. The hybrid strain is inoculated into PDA rich solid medium and cultured in a 25°C incubator. This operation is performed four times in succession to determine the stability of the hybrid strain. The hybridization of the monokaryon strains of the two parents obtains 10 hybrid strains, which are named WCS1-1, WCS1-2, WCS1-3, WCS1-4, WCS1-5, WCS1-6, WCS1-7, WCS1-8, WCS1-9, and WCS1-10 in sequence.
[0022] Example 2 Antagonistic test Three different strains (parent and hybrid strains) are inoculated on the same PDA rich solid medium with a diameter of 8 mm and cultured in a 25°C constant temperature incubator. The mycelial growth is observed, and the antagonistic phenomenon is observed after about one week. The strength of the antagonistic line is compared and determined.
[0023] The antagonistic experiment of the hybrid strain and the parent is shown in Figure 1 and Figure 2 All hybrid strains have antagonistic lines with the parent. Compared with the parent CS3, the antagonistic lines of all hybrid strains with the parent BC1 are more obvious. Among them, WCS1-9 has very obvious antagonistic lines with the parent CS3 and the parent BC1.
[0024] Example 3 Analysis of properties of new varieties 3.1 Mycelial growth test at different temperatures The mycelial growth at different temperatures was tested, and the results showed that the growth rate of different strains increased first and then decreased with the increase of temperature, and reached the highest at 25°C. Specifically, when the culture temperature was 10°C, the strains were in the germination state, and the cold resistance of BC1 was relatively strong, and there was no significant difference among the other strains; when the culture temperature was 25°C, the growth rate of different strains from high to low was WCS1-9>BC1>CS3>CS2, and the growth rate of WCS1-9 was 11.09±0.13 mm / d, which was higher than that of the control varieties and the main cultivated variety; the mycelium of WCS1-9 showed good roundness, the colony was relatively dense, and the mycelium was white Figure 3 ). When the culture temperature was 30°C, the growth rate of different strains from high to low was WCS1-9>CS3>BC1>CS2, and the heat resistance of WCS1-9 strain was stronger than that of the other strains.
[0025] 3.2 Description of mushroom characteristics The cap morphology and gill distribution morphology of WCS1-9 were the same as those of the main cultivated variety CS2; in terms of cap color, WCS1-9 and CS2 were both dark brown, which gradually became lighter from the middle to the outside; in terms of stem color and hair, the main cultivated variety CS2 was dark brown with the same color on the upper and lower parts and dense hair, and WCS1-9 was light brown with the same color on the upper and lower parts and sparse hair; in terms of stem, the stem of WCS1-9 was white before and after drying, which was significantly different from that of the main cultivated variety CS2; in terms of gill color, WCS1-9 was light brown, and the main cultivated variety CS2 was dark brown, which could be seen from Figure 4 .
[0026] 3.3 Main yield and agronomic performance 3.3.1 Main yield performance: 'Fucha No. 1' WCS1-9 was cultivated for 60 days, the first flush of mushrooms was harvested for 10 days, the average fresh mushroom yield was 158.53 g / bag, the second flush of mushrooms was harvested for 25 days, the average fresh mushroom yield was 195.40 g / bag, and the average fresh mushroom yield of the first two flushes was 353.93 g / bag. Gucha No. 2 (control) was cultivated for 60 days, the first flush of mushrooms was harvested for 11 days, the average fresh mushroom yield was 145.26 g / bag, the second flush of mushrooms was harvested for 25 days, the average fresh mushroom yield was 181.00 g / bag, and the average fresh mushroom yield of the first two flushes was 326.26 g / bag. Compared with the control, 'Fucha No. 1' WCS1-9 had a 1-day shorter first flush of mushrooms and an 8.48% higher yield of the first two flushes (see Table 1). The average cap diameter and thickness of 'Fucha No. 1' WCS1-9 were 34.53 mm and 15.20 mm, respectively, at the time of first flush harvesting, and the average stem length and diameter were 17.42 cm and 9.18 mm, respectively. The average cap diameter and thickness of Gucha No. 2 (control) were 30.79 mm and 11.01 mm, respectively, at the time of harvesting, and the average stem length and diameter were 13.73 cm and 7.39 mm, respectively (see Table 2). Field yield measurement showed that the new variety of 'Fucha No. 1' WCS1-9 had obvious characteristics, high yield, shortened mushrooming period, good commercial traits, and better overall performance than the control variety.

[0031] Example 4 DNA fingerprint identification of new variety The target new variety is further identified by Indel marker method. The total DNA of Agrocybe aegerita is extracted according to the instruction of Ezup column fungus genomic DNA extraction kit. The total DNA of WCS1-9, BC1 and CS3 is sent to Shengong Bioengineering (Shanghai) Co., Ltd. for whole genome sequencing. The Genome Anlysis Toolkit (GATK) software is used for analysis by using HaplotypeCaller algorithm. The InDel fragment is obtained by comparing the genome sequence information of WCS1-9 with BC1 and CS3 as reference genome. The specific primers for verifying the InDel fragment of WCS1-9 are designed by Primer Premier 5 software at the corresponding site of the reference genome, and the primer sequences are listed in Table 4, and the synthesis is entrusted to Shengong Bioengineering (Shanghai) Co., Ltd. The genomic DNA of WCS1-9, BC1 and CS3 is amplified by InDel-PCR using the specific amplification primers in Table 4.
[0032] The InDel-PCR reaction system is as follows: 1 μL of each of the upstream and downstream primers, 1 μL of DNA template, 12.5 μL of 2×EasyTaq PCR SuperMix (Beijing Quanshi Gold Biotechnology Co., Ltd.), and 9.5 μL of ddH2O.
[0033] The InDel-PCR reaction program is as follows: 94℃ pre-denaturation for 5 min; 94℃ denaturation for 30 s, 67℃ annealing for 30 s, 72℃ extension for 1 min, 33 cycles, 72℃ extension for 5 min, and 4℃ storage.
[0034] The amplification product is detected by 1% agarose gel electrophoresis at 120V.
[0035] The target fragment is cut off and recovered according to the method provided in the instruction of Gel Extraction Kit D2500 gel recovery kit. The purified DNA sample is sent to Shengong Bioengineering (Shanghai) Co., Ltd. for sequencing.

[0043] In summary, the tea tree mushroom new variety 'Fucha No. 1' (WCS1-9) provided by the application takes 'Zhongjunbaitian No. 1' (BC1) with strong disease resistance and white mushroom body and 'Tongmaogu' (CS3) with strong ability of degrading cellulose and lignin in substrate as parents, and an excellent hybrid strain 'Fucha No. 1' (WCS1-9) is obtained through the method of protoplast mononuclear hybridization. The multiple batch test results of cultivation production test and agronomic trait identification show that when the cultivation period is 60 days, the average yield of 'Fucha No. 1' (WCS1-9) is 366.19 g / bag, the average yield of the control variety is 329.64 g / bag, and the average yield is increased by 11.09%.
[0044] There is no obvious difference in the main nutritional component composition between 'Fucha No. 1' (WCS1-9) and the main cultivar (CS3), the content of crude protein is increased by 31.09% compared with the control, and the production period is shortened by 7-10 days. The fruiting body is scattered, the cap color is lighter than the control, the stipe is light yellow white, hollow, and the surface has less fluff, the gill is light brown and wave-shaped, and the above characteristics are obviously different from the control; after multiple passages, the production is stable, the characteristic traits are obvious, and good production stability is achieved.
